Amazon Elastic Container Registry (Amazon ECR) is a managed container registry that facilitates storage, management, sharing, and deployment of container images and artifacts. It eliminates the need to operate your container repositories or scale the underlying infrastructure. Images hosted are highly available and have a high-performance architecture, allowing deployments with reliability.

Netsurion Open XDR monitors events from Amazon ECR by parsing the AWS CloudTrail logs and triggers from Amazon EventBridge. Dashboards and reports in Netsurion Open XDR allow you to monitor the overall actions that are being performed related to the Amazon ECR service to keep you informed about its activities. It will trigger alerts whenever an action that is critical to the service is carried out.

For a new instance, integrate the AWS instance to Netsurion Open XDR using the Netsurion integrator lambda function, which will in turn deliver logs to Netsurion Open XDR from AWS. For an already-integrated AWS instance, make sure to update to ETS-AWS-LogForwarder v1.1.0 or above.
